Voor onze opdrachtgever zijn wij op zoek naar een Senior Solution Designer & Fullstack Developer (.NET/Angular). Je speelt een sleutelrol in het replatformen van MS-Access-applicaties naar moderne webapplicaties, waarbij je zowel het functionele ontwerp als de technische realisatie oppakt. Je werkt zelfstandig binnen een Agile-team en levert een concrete bijdrage aan hoogwaardige en veilige applicaties voor Defensie. Zoek jij een opdracht met inhoud, maatschappelijke relevantie én technische diepgang? Dan is dit jouw kans.
Senior Solution Designer & Fullstack Developer (.NET/Angular)
- Region: Utrecht
- Start: between November and December, depending on screening
- Hours per week: 36
- Duration: 12 months with option for extension
Senior Solution Designer & Fullstack Developer (.NET/Angular)
- Region: Utrecht
- Start: between November and December, depending on screening
- Hours per week: 36
- Duration: 12 months with option for extension
Senior Solution Designer & Fullstack Developer (.NET/Angular)
- Region: Utrecht
- Start: between November and December, depending on screening
- Hours per week: 36
- Duration: 12 months with option for extension
Senior Solution Designer & Fullstack Developer (.NET/Angular)
- Region: Utrecht
- Start: between November and December, depending on screening
- Hours per week: 36
- Duration: 12 months with option for extension
Work
What will you do?
- Analyseren van bestaande MS-Access-applicaties en het vertalen naar nieuwe functionele en technische eisen in overleg met stakeholders.
- Opstellen van een Minimum Viable Product (MVP) als basis voor de nieuwe webapplicatie.
- Ontwerpen van technische oplossingen die aansluiten op de bestaande architectuur.
- Identificeren van technische ontwerprisico’s en toezien op ingebouwde kwaliteit en beveiliging.
- Ontwikkelen en integreren van webapplicatiecomponenten in .NET Core, Angular, EF Core en RESTful API’s.
- Optimaliseren van prestaties, beveiliging en schaalbaarheid van applicaties.
- Onderhouden en doorontwikkelen van bestaande (geherplatformde) webapplicaties.
- Analyseren en oplossen van storingen en bugs in de applicaties.
- Werken met T-SQL en SQL Server (inclusief stored procedures, constraints en datamodellering).
- Samenwerken in een klein, multifunctioneel team volgens Agile-werkwijze.
Context and objective
- De opdracht vindt plaats binnen het team "Kleinschalige Applicaties" van Defensie.
- Het team beheert en vernieuwt applicaties binnen de keten Materieel, Logistiek & Financieel management.
- Doel is het replatformen van MS-Access-applicaties naar webapplicaties (o.b.v. .NET/Angular) i.v.m. Life Cycle Management.
- Het team is verantwoordelijk voor beheer, instandhouding én doorontwikkeling van deze applicaties.
- De functioneel-technische eisen worden samen met stakeholders vertaald naar een MVP.
- De omgeving vereist kennis van interfaces, mede vanwege koppelingen met een zelfstandig netwerk in de VS.
- Zelfstandig werken binnen een klein team is cruciaal.
- Er wordt gewerkt volgens Agile-methodiek met korte iteraties.
Job requirements
- 2 jaar ervaring op het gebied van het schrijven van software ontwerpen.
- 5 jaar ervaring op het gebied van software realisatie in .Net/ Angular.
- Je beschikt over een hbo diploma.
- Je beschikt over goede uitdrukkingsvaardigheden in zowel Nederlands als Engels.
- 5 jaar ervaring met Angular en Typescript.
- 7 jaar ervaring in de afgelopen 10 jaar met .Net Core, EF Core, WebAPI (REST), #C en SQL.
- 8 jaar ervaring in de afgelopen 10 jaar met Concepten Open (Codeer) standaarden en Webtechnologie (HTML5 en CSS3).
Wishes
- Ervaring met MS-Acces in de afgelopen 10 jaar.
- Ervaring met Jest Unittesten in de afgelopen 5 jaar.
- Ervaring met Azure DevOps- Services in de afgelopen 5 jaar.
- Ervaring met GIT in de afgelopen 5 jaar.
- Ervaring met ProxyService en kennis van het koppelen van diverse API's en externe koppelingen in de afgelopen 5 jaar.
- Ervaring met het analyseren van gebruikersbehoefte, opstellen van functionele en technische eisen gecombineerd met analytisch en probleemoplossend vermogen in de afgelopen 5 jaar.
Ministry of Defence
- Deployments to Defence are usually for longer periods (1 to 4 years maximum). This position requires a B-screening with an average duration of 6-8 weeks.
- When offering a candidate, completion of the offer form is mandatory. This also asks you to explain the requirements and wishes + include a reference to the CV.
Specific to suppliers
When you offer a professional with us and they are placed, we need information from you as a contracting party. Among other things, with regard to the Wet Ketenaansprakelijkheid. The ‘WKA’ aims to prevent abuse in the payment of payroll taxes at all links in the chain; from supplier to end customer.
Broker parties cover these risks for their customers. To limit liability, measures need to be taken. So too by Hero. Important here is WAADI registration and use of a blocked account, the G account. This is the account into which only payroll taxes and VAT are deposited, which are then paid to the tax authorities. You can apply for the G account from the Tax and Customs Administration.
If you have any questions about this, you can always call us on 085-222 1996 or email us at defensie@hero.eu.
Current assignments
Is the right assignment not among them for you right now? Then take advantage of our open registration. Or activate a job alert!
Want more information or have any questions? Please contact me.
Coosje Carels
Want more information or have any questions? Please contact me.
Coosje Carels
The procedure
1. Application
Puda nes repedipienti at ut labore vero expel enditatureVelest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
2. Telephone introduction
Puda nes repedipienti at ut labore vero expel enditatureVelest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
3. Conversation with client
Puda nes repedipienti at ut labore vero expel enditatureVelest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
4. Signing agreement
Puda nes repedipienti at ut labore vero expel enditatureVelest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
5. Getting started
Puda nes repedipienti at ut labore vero expel enditatureVelest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
1. Application
Puda nes repedipienti at ut labore vero expel enditature Velest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
2. Telephone introduction
Puda nes repedipienti at ut labore vero expel enditature Velest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
3. Conversation with client
Puda nes repedipienti at ut labore vero expel enditatureVelest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
4. Signing agreement
Puda nes repedipienti at ut labore vero expel enditature Velest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ent audaepedis evelest.
5. Getting started
Puda nes repedipienti at ut labore vero expel enditature Velestium adi illor am que aut landitas dolorum et omnieni modiosa natiaepelent evelest.
Want to know more about Hero?
Contact us at:
+31 (0) 85 222 1999
Would you like to send an open application?
For anyone who has no idea what Hero does, but would like to know, we have developed a special website where we explain our services in simple terms: Hero for Dummies
